The release date of Florian Zeller's The Son, the much-anticipated followup to the director's exceptional 2021 film The Father, is just around the corner. A celebrated playwright, Zeller has adapted The Son into a film from one of his plays; an exciting prospect, as The Father also began as a stage play. Featuring an all-star cast that includes Hugh Jackman, Laura Dern, Anthony Hopkins, and Vanessa Kirby, The Son looks set to dive deep into the nuances of mental health and family relationships in a dramatic and gripping fashion.

Just as The Son has attracted top-tier acting talent, it has done the same with music; the movie's score was written by German film composer Hans Zimmer. Perhaps second in name recognition only to the zeitgeist-defining John Williams, Zimmer has scored some of the best-known films of all time including The Dark Knight trilogy, Gladiator, and The Lion King (1994 and 2019). Hans Zimmer also recently won an Academy Award thanks to his outstanding score for 2021's Dune. "Love Is Not Enough" is a rich and dramatic track that fits the emotional nature of the film itself. The evocative string melodies, swelling pulse, and wandering chord progression of the piece come together to expertly craft something as beautiful as it is somber. "Love Is Not Enough" is also a wonderful example of Hans Zimmer's wide range, as much of the composer's best-known work is bigger and more bombastic than this track from The Son. On working on The Son, Hans Zimmer had the following to say:

“I had always wanted to work with Florian having been so moved by ‘The Father.’ This film is so rich in its depiction of the struggle to maintain one’s mental health and the wide swathe of emotions displayed by all of the connected characters, I found it remarkably moving to be able to enhance and frame those emotions as empathetically as I could with the orchestra.”
